Rapid industrialization ,urbanization and population growth management of solid waste in India’s growing areas is a challenging problem current practices of unscientific waste dumping of domestic waste have created serious environmental and public health concern .This study attempts to serous municipal solid waste management (MSWM).This study attempts to Lucknow capital city of Uttar Pradesh ,by a primary survey of 150 households segregated on the basis of income and settlement profile .the entire study area was divided as A (low income group),B (medium income group),C (high income group),and living standard goes up .So quantity of solid waste increases in higher societies .prevailing scenario of waste handling practices and disposal is an alarming problem encountered by many of the urban and industrial area thus an integrated solid waste management in sustainable approach is therefore efforts should be made by active participation of community public and private agencies to solve this problem.
